Move Over ‘Farout,’ Astronomers Confirm ‘Farfarout’ Is the Solar System’s Most Distant Known Object – Gizmodo Australia

What astronomers believed to be the most distant object in the Solar System, Farout, has lost its title after just two years. That crown now goes to Farfarout (zero points for creativity, you guys), a planetoid that is more than 130 times farther from the Sun than Earth is.
As spotted by Inverse, after years of observations, astronomers have confirmed that the planetoid designated by the Minor Planet Centre as 2018 AG37, nicknamed Farfarout, is the farthest known Solar System object at 132 astronomical…
